Circle Set To Reveal Update On USDC Ecosystem Boost

Circle Set To Reveal Update On USDC Ecosystem Boost

USDC stablecoin issuer Circle is likely set to make a big announcement soon following the recent revelation that US-based crypto exchange Coinbase acquired a stake in the company. The deal announcement came at a crucial time when the US lawmakers are working on a bill to regulate the stablecoin market.

On the other side, Paul Grewal, the Chief Legal Officer at Coinbase, expressed his opinion on the stablecoin legislation in the United States. He said the regulatory environment around the US stablecoin legislation is the “most confused.”

Stablecoins Are Here To Stay

Grewal stressed on the question of whether or not the United States could embrace the stablecoin market or lose it offshore. In June 2023, the US House Financial Services Committee had released a draft stablecoin bill “The Future of Digital Assets: Providing Clarity for the Digital Asset Ecosystem.” However, there was a no deal scenario in the US Congress as negotiation talks failed.

In the last one year, the USDC market cap fell from $52 billion to $24 billion currently, whereas during the same time frame, the Tether USDt (USDT) market size grew from $68 billion to $83 billion currently.
